Gift (12)
- Platinum experience ticket for me and standard ticket for a staff member to CPAC 2025 from Conservative Political Action Network LtdDeclared since 22 Sept 2025Holder not statedGiftPDF ↗
- Office Foxtel Subscription QANTAS Chairman's Club Membership Virgin Australia Beyond Lounge Membership Copies of SA Life Magazine from Toop and Toop Real Estate Subscription to www.public.news website from Michael SchellenbergerDeclared since 6 Aug 2025Holder not statedGiftPDF ↗
- Declared since 12 June 2025
- Declared since 14 Oct 2024
- Platinum experience ticket to CPAC 2024 from Conservative Political Action Network LtdDeclared since 8 Oct 2024Holder not statedGiftPDF ↗
- 1 x complimentary ticket to the Australian Freedom Conference Cairns event and ancillary hospitality from Mineralogy Pty Ltd.Declared since 3 July 2024Holder not statedGiftPDF ↗
- 4 x complimentary tickets to the Australian Freedom Conference Adelaide event from Mineralogy Pty LtdDeclared since 3 July 2024Holder not statedGiftPDF ↗
- 2 x Tickets to the Royal Flying Doctor Service SA/NT - 2024 'Wings for Life' Gala Ball from Hancock AgricultureDeclared since 6 May 2024Holder not statedGiftPDF ↗
- 56 copies of the book "Cancel Culture" by Dr Kevin Donnelly from Wilkinson Publishing to be given awayDeclared since 5 Apr 2023Holder not statedGiftPDF ↗
- Office Foxtel subscription QANTAS Chairman's Club membership Virgin Australia Beyond Lounge MembershipDeclared since 22 Aug 2022Holder not statedGiftPDF ↗
- Declared since 19 July 2019
- Declared since 19 July 2019
Sponsored travel (7)
- Complimentary change to an earlier flight from Melbourne to Adelaide and exit row upgrade from Virgin Airlines.Declared since 2 May 2025Holder not statedSponsored travelPDF ↗
- Dinner and hospitality provided by Mrs Gina Rinehart and/or Hancock ProspectingDeclared since 2 May 2025Holder not statedSponsored travelPDF ↗
- Upgrade (unsolicited) to business class from QANTAS travelling from Canberra to Adelaide on 29 November 2024 (for myself, wife and child)Declared since 2 Dec 2024Holder not statedSponsored travelPDF ↗
- Hospitality in the form of return flights and accommodation from the Assange Campaign Inc for the purposes of participating in a Parliamentary delegation to Washington DC in September 2023.Declared since 29 Sept 2023Holder not statedSponsored travelPDF ↗
- Upgrade to CPAC Australia 2023 Conference Platinum experience from CPAC Australia (including one staff member)Declared since 22 Aug 2023Holder not statedSponsored travelPDF ↗
- Return economy class airfare, 3 nights’ accommodation from 30 October 2023 to 1 November 2023 and incidental hospitality received from Alliance for Responsible Citizenship for the purposes of attending 2023 ARC Forum Conference in London.Declared since 7 June 2023Holder not statedSponsored travelPDF ↗
- 1 x ticket to the Adelaide Crows v Essendon football match at the Adelaide Oval together with associated hospitality. Provided by Optus.Declared since 24 July 2019Holder not statedSponsored travelPDF ↗
